Anyone know of any Decent Lakes within an hour of Tampa? Family has a Lake house in Ocala, But am looking for something closer for a buddy to get his boat out more regular.
Old    LR3w8kbrdr            03-14-2012, 8:27 AM Reply   
Not many public lakes around here but there is Tarpon lake, Lake Seminole & Lake Thonotosassa and sometimes guys will go out in the Hillsborough river. Everything else is private lakes...wish I still had my access to Lake magdalene (one of the best in tampa).
Old     (jaybee)      Join Date: Aug 2007       03-14-2012, 9:59 AM Reply   
The best spot in Tampa is The Hillsborough river. It is protected on both sides so even on windy days you can find a smooth strip. Bit tricky to find the ramp as its in someones back yard though.

As far as Thonotosassa the ramp you are looking at will not work for wake boats because it is waaaaaay to narrow and shallow from what I remember. There is a ramp right on the lake. I forget the name of the road its on though. I also believe you have to pay to launch from Thonotosassa but if you get there at the right time it really is a pretty decent smaller lake.
